Sony Computer Entertainment America today released the newest firmware update for the PSP®(PlayStation®Portable) system, version 3.50, adding Remote Play connectivity with the PLAYSTATION®3 (PS3®) system via wireless Internet and an RSS Channel Guide.
In other news, new content will be available on the PLAYSTATION®Store today, including the arcade classic, Championship Sprint™, which is downloadable in its entirety, as well as videos and trailers for MLB 07 The Show™ and Ridge Racer®7.
PSP Firmware 3.50
PSP Firmware 3.50 is now available for download and includes the following updates:
Remote Play – As announced last week, the Remote Play feature for using a PSP system to access photos, videos, and music on a PS3 system’s hard drive has been enhanced, enabling consumers to connect their PSP system from outside of their own home via any accessible Wi-Fi Internet connection. With today’s PSP firmware update, that functionality is now live. Users must also update their PS3 firmware to the current version, 1.80.
Really Simple Syndication (RSS) Channel Guide – An index of RSS audio and video feeds, or podcasts, is now accessible from the XrossMediaBar (XMB™), under the RSS Channel icon, providing PSP owners with another destination to find and play back RSS content.

PSP system firmware updates can be wirelessly downloaded directly to a PSP system using a Wi-Fi connection; downloaded to a PC from http://www.us.playstation.com/psp and transferred to a PSP system through a USB cable; or installed using upcoming UMDâ„¢ software.
